The Landscape of Cap Manufacturing in China

China’s manufacturing prowess in textiles and apparel is well-established, and the cap industry is a specialized segment within this larger ecosystem. Concentrated in industrial regions such as Guangdong, Zhejiang, and Shandong provinces, manufacturers range from large-scale factories with fully integrated production lines to smaller, agile workshops specializing in niche or high-end products. This diversity allows them to handle orders of virtually any volume, from small custom batches for startups to massive bulk orders for global brands. The infrastructure supports every stage of production, from fabric sourcing and dyeing to embroidery, printing, assembly, and quality control.

Core Strengths and Capabilities

The dominance of Chinese cap manufacturers is built on several key strengths:

1. Vertical Integration and Supply Chain Efficiency: Many leading manufacturers control multiple stages of the production process. They often have direct access to raw materials like cotton, polyester, wool, and specialized fabrics, as well as components such as buckles, eyelets, and patches. This integration reduces lead times, manages costs effectively, and ensures consistency in material quality.

2. Advanced Production Technology: Modern Chinese factories are equipped with state-of-the-art machinery for automated cutting, high-speed embroidery (using multi-head embroidery machines), precise printing (including sublimation and silk-screen), and efficient assembly. This technological adoption ensures precision, scalability, and the ability to execute complex designs.

3. Customization and Flexibility: The ability to offer extensive customization is a major selling point. Manufacturers work closely with clients to create custom caps from the ground up—selecting fabric, style (e.g., structured/unstructured, panel design), color, closure type (snapback, strapback, fitted), and adding logos or artwork through embroidery, printing, or patches. They are adept at translating client concepts into tangible products.

4. Quality Assurance and Compliance: Reputable manufacturers adhere to international quality standards and have robust Quality Control (QC) protocols in place. This includes inspections of raw materials, in-process checks during sewing and assembly, and final random inspections before shipment. Many comply with social accountability and environmental regulations, which is crucial for Western brands.

The Manufacturing Process: From Design to Delivery

A typical journey with a Chinese cap manufacturer involves a collaborative, multi-step process:

Design and Sampling: It begins with design consultation. Clients provide ideas or tech packs, and manufacturers create digital mock-ups. Upon approval, a physical sample (proto sample) is produced for fit, feel, and design verification. This stage is critical for ensuring the final product meets expectations.

Material Sourcing and Preparation: Once the sample is approved, the factory sources and prepares the confirmed materials. Fabrics are cut into panels using automated machines for uniformity.

Embroidery and Printing: Logo and design application occurs at this stage. Embroidery is favored for a premium, durable finish, while printing is used for full-color graphics or detailed artwork.

Sewing and Assembly: Skilled workers sew the cap panels together, attach the brim (often reinforced with plastic or cardboard for shape), and add the sweatband, closure, and any additional accessories.

Quality Control and Packaging: Finished caps undergo thorough inspection for defects in stitching, alignment, and overall finish. They are then shaped, often using steam, and packaged according to client specifications—whether on individual hanger cards, in poly bags, or in bulk cartons.

Logistics and Shipping: Manufacturers usually have experience in arranging shipping and handling export documentation, facilitating smooth delivery to international ports.

Considerations for Global Buyers

When sourcing from China cap manufacturers, due diligence is essential:

Supplier Verification: Conduct background checks, request business licenses, and seek references. Platforms like Alibaba can be starting points, but deeper verification is recommended.

Communication: Clear, detailed communication is vital. Use precise tech packs with measurements, Pantone colors, and explicit artwork files.

Visit and Audit: If possible, visiting the factory or hiring a third-party inspection service provides invaluable insight into their operations, working conditions, and quality processes.

Understand Costs: The quoted price should be broken down (materials, labor, customization, shipping). The lowest price may not equate to the best value when considering quality and reliability.

Intellectual Property Protection: Ensure contracts include confidentiality and IP protection clauses to safeguard your designs.
